On 5th of September 2013, Hon’ble CM of Gujarat Shri Narendra Modi along with Hon’ble Governor Dr. Shrimati Kamlaji will present the Best Teachers Award to teachers of the State in a grand function to celebrate Teacher’s Day 2013 at Town Hall, Gandhinagar. The function will be attended by many of State ministers and thousands of teachers and students from across Gujarat.

Education is a topic very close to Shri Narendra Modi’s heart. He will address the gathering with his inspiring address on Teacher’s Day which will be broadcasted LIVE. You can watch it LIVE here  from 10:30 am onwards.

Teacher’s Day 2013

In the 2nd phase of the programme, Shri Narendra Modi will interact with thousands of children from across Gujarat who will be present on the occasion. This is not the first time he will be doing that on Teacher’s Day. Several times before, he has answered questions on his ambition, his dreams, his life, his inspiration and to many other questions posed by the students on Teachers Day. Prime Minister, Shri Narendra Modi will visit Karnataka on 15th April 2026. At around 11 AM, Prime Minister will inaugurate the Sri Guru Bhairavaikya Mandira at Sri Kshetra Adichunchanagiri in Mandya district. He will also address the gathering on the occasion.

During the visit, Prime Minister will also jointly release the book titled “Saundarya Lahari and Shiva Mahimna Stotram” along with former Prime Minister Shri H. D. Deve Gowda ji.

Sri Guru Bhairavaikya Mandira is a memorial dedicated to the revered seer, Sri Sri Sri Dr. Balagangadharanatha Mahaswamiji, the 71st Pontiff of Sri Adichunchanagiri Mahasamsthana Math. Constructed in the traditional Dravidian architectural style, the Mandira stands as a tribute to the life and legacy of the late seer. The Mandira is envisioned not only as a place of reverence but also as a source of inspiration for future generations.

Sri Sri Sri Dr. Balagangadharanatha Mahaswamiji was widely respected for his lifelong commitment to social service, having established numerous educational institutions and healthcare facilities. He firmly believed that service to society is the highest form of worship, and his teachings transcended barriers of caste, creed, and region, inspiring millions.
